A transverse harmonic wave travels on a rope according to the following expression: y(x,t) = 0.17sin(2.0x + 17.5t) The mass density of the rope is ? = 0.112 kg/m. x and y are measured in meters and t in seconds.

1) What is the amplitude of the wave?

2) What is the frequency of oscillation of the wave?

3) What is the wavelength of the wave?

4) What is the speed of the wave?

5) What is the tension in the rope?

6) At x = 3.7 m and t = 0.42 s, what is the velocity of the rope? (watch your sign)

7) At x = 3.7 m and t = 0.42 s, what is the acceleration of the rope? (watch your sign)

8) What is the average speed of the rope during one complete oscillation of the rope?
